Summary

Judith P. Hoyer Montessori is a public PK-8 magnet school in Landover, MD, serving 361 students within the Prince George's County Public Schools district, and it stands out as a high-performing option in an area where many nearby schools struggle.

This school’s academic performance is a major draw, especially in English Language Arts (ELA), where 61.3% of all students were proficient in 2025-2026—far above the district average of 38.9% and the state average of 51.7%. This is dramatically higher than nearby schools like Highland Park Elementary and Carmody Hills Elementary, both at 17.3% proficiency. In upper-grade math, the Montessori approach shines: 45.5% of 6th graders were proficient in math, compared to just 10.9% in the district, and 8th-grade math proficiency (28%) is nearly three times the state average (9.6%). The school also excels at serving all students, ranking in the 68th percentile for male students and the 64th percentile for low socio-economic status students statewide, showing it effectively closes achievement gaps.

Another standout feature is the school’s exceptionally low chronic absenteeism rate of 7.5% in 2023-2024, compared to the district average of 32.7%. This is a stark contrast to nearby schools like Seat Pleasant Elementary (52.5%) and Robert R. Gray Elementary (45.5%), suggesting a highly engaged student body and strong school culture. While science scores in 8th grade (12% proficiency) lag behind the state average (30.9%), the school’s consistent upward trend—from the 32nd percentile in 2021-2022 to the 60th percentile in 2025-2026—indicates effective leadership and teaching. Notably, its success isn’t driven by higher spending ($21,229 per student), as schools like Robert R. Gray ($29,055) and Seat Pleasant ($31,455) spend more but achieve far less, highlighting the power of the Montessori model and school culture.

by a parent
Saturday, October 27, 2018

Open Quote The school has to follow the Common Core because it is a county public school however, they do a great job continuing the Montessori curriculum at the same time! My daughter started in Pre-K 3 where they were a half day student, which is why they did not participate in all activities. They welcome me into the building whenever I want to volunteer, you just have to have the county required background check. They take the students on multiple field trips and provide a lot of wonderful experiences! My only concern is the communication between the school and parents. They do everything via Rallyhood and sometimes it is not the most effective way to communicate as well, sometimes the communication is sent out with very short notice for the parents.
My daughter loves it here! The school is preparing the students for high school and beyond. I am glad they have to incorporate the Common Core and the standards and expectations for the state curriculum because the county does not have a Montessori High School and therefore our students have to be able to adjust to the "regular" school life, which many students who come from Montessori struggle to do. They provide a good balance for our children! Close Quote
